- Notes - Scientific name: Ducula aenea Family: Columbidae Local name: Balud, Baud (Pil) Other common names: Chestnut-naped Imperial-pigeon (paulina); Enggano Imperial-pigeon (oenothorax) Conservation status: LC (Least Concern) Pale vinaceous gray; mantle, back, wings, and tail metallic green with coppery reflections; under tail-coverts dark chestnut. This is a lowland species ascending up to 4000 feet. The Green Imperial Pigeon is common wherever sufficientforest exists. It flies high and well, and its voice is a deep, raucous coo.
